You always take best player available if you are asking. Someday far, far down the road you might tweak that strategy but my experience has been if you are asking you go best player available.

I would in no way pass on a player just because I have his team mates already rostered.

DynastyDabbler wrote: Sat May 06, 2023 8:07 am I agree with all your replies, but it’s a little unsettling when you factor in the other players on my roster. I have 3 bengals, 3 Seahawks (5 if I got JSN and Charb) and presumably the JAX backfield if I got Tank. Is it bad strategy to have some much invested in these offenses?
Unless trading is impossible in your league. No. Draft value and trade later for something that fits better if you want. And even then, the NFL changes so fast, you’re probably better off still just drafting value anyway.
